Kingman sits in the middle of America's longest continuous stretch of Route 66 (158 miles) — and 2026 is the Route 66 Centennial year, with major events all year. The Arizona Route 66 Museum at the Powerhouse was just renovated for the Centennial with a new 3D map, interactive kiosks, immersive vinyl walls, and a dog park out front. Historic Downtown's self-guided walking tour covers 40+ sites on the National Register. Convertibles and classic-style sedans are popular for the Route 66 cruise; SUVs handle the Cerbat Foothills trails and the dirt out to White Cliffs Wagon Trail (1800s wagon tracks visible from a mile from town). Big 2026 dates: The Drive Home VII (Jan 4–5), Route 66 Race for Hospice (Apr 18), Route 66 Street Drags (Oct 9–11), Beale Street Theater documentary screening (Oct 15), and the Kingman Route 66 Fest (Oct 16–17). Driving tip: I-40 is the fast route, but locals do Route 66 west out to Oatman (the wild burro town, 30 min) — slow, scenic, totally worth it.
